Ingredients

For the Donuts:

  • 6 glazed donuts (store-bought or homemade)
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• ¼ c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up fresh strawberries, diced
  • ¼ cup strawberry syrup or jam

For the Crunch Topping:

  • ¼ cup crushed strawberry shortcake cookies or graham crackers

Optional:

  • Extra strawberry syrup or more crushed cookies for garnish

Instructions

1. Make the Cheesecake Filling

In a medium bowl, beat together:

  • Softened cream cheese
  • Powdered sugar
  • Vanilla extract

Once smooth, add the heavy cream and whip until light, fluffy, and pipeable. Chill briefly if needed to firm up.


2. Sweeten the Strawberries

In a separate bowl:

  • Toss diced strawberries with strawberry syrup or jam
  • Mix until they’re well coated and juicy

3. Assemble the Donut Sandwiches

  • Slice each glazed donut in half horizontally
  • Spread or pipe a thick layer of cheesecake filling onto the bottom half
  • Add a spoonful of the strawberry mixture
  • Sprinkle with crushed cookies for that sweet crunch

4. Finish with Crunch & Drizzle

  • Place the top donut half back on gently
  • Drizzle with extra strawberry syrup and a final dusting of crushed cookies for that signature “crunch” look

Serve immediately—or chill for 10–15 minutes if you want them slightly set.


Tips for Success

  • Use softened cream cheese for a smooth filling
  • Whip the filling until fluffy for that authentic cheesecake texture
  • Want extra crunch? Add a bit of crushed cookie inside the donut too
  • Make ahead: Fill them a couple hours early, but wait to drizzle and crunch until just before serving

Storage & Leftovers

  • Best served immediately for that perfect texture
  • Store filled donuts in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 1 day
  • Drizzle and crunch topping should be added just before serving to stay crispy
